FAQ

What is LASEK surgery?

LASEK surgery is a vision correction procedure that uses laser technology to reshape the cornea, improving vision and reducing the need for glasses or contact lenses. It is a less invasive alternative to LASIK and is suitable for patients with thin corneas or those who engage in contact sports.

How long is the recovery period after LASEK?

The recovery period for LASEK surgery typically ranges from one to two weeks. During this time, patients may experience some discomfort, including sensitivity to light and mild pain. However, most patients notice significant improvements in their vision within a few days.

Is LASEK surgery painful?

LASEK surgery is generally painless, as patients receive local anesthesia in the form of eye drops. Some discomfort may be experienced during the recovery period, but this can be managed with prescribed pain medication and proper aftercare.

Are there any risks or complications associated with LASEK?

Like any surgical procedure, LASEK carries some risks and potential complications, including infection, under- or over-correction, and temporary visual disturbances. However, these risks are minimal when the procedure is performed by experienced professionals in a well-equipped facility.

Can I drive after LASEK surgery?

Patients are advised not to drive immediately after LASEK surgery, as their vision may be blurry or unstable. It is recommended to arrange for transportation home and to avoid driving until your ophthalmologist confirms that your vision is stable and safe for driving.
